Regions :: Middle East ChemChina Seeks to Cut Valuation of the Stake It May Buy in Makhteshim9:24 AM MST | November 22, 2010 | Ian Young China National Chemical Corp. (ChemChina; Beijing) is seeking to reduce the size of the stake in Makhteshim Agan Industries (Tel Aviv) that it is negotiating to acquire from Koor Industries (Tel Aviv), and cut the valuation of the Makhteshim Agan shares it may buy, Koor says. Koor announced in October 2010 that it was negotiating to sell 17% of Makhteshim Agan to ChemChina, and that ChemChina was planning to purchase all of the Makhteshim Agan shares that are publicly traded.
